The brightness of the Asus ROG Swift is definitely higher than that of an OLED display. What OLED can always do better is contrast, because backlit LED screens can never do that so well. IPS panels in particular are pretty weak when it comes to contrast. The LG OLED can also do HDMI 2.1, the ROG Swift can only do HDMI 2.0. And the LG OLED screen is cheaper.
